Dandapur

Dandapur is a village located in Contai I subdivision of Purba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. Tamluk and Contai are the district & sub-district headquarters of Dandapur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Raipur Paschimbarh is the gram panchayat of Dandapur village.

About Dandap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dandapur is 346164. The village spans a total geographical area of 17.55 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721401. Contai is nearest town to Dandap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 4km away.

Population of Dandapur

Below is a concise population overview of Dandapur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 387 199 188
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 33 13 20
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 284 168 116
Illiterate Population 103 31 72

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dandapur village:

  • The total population of Dandapur village is around 387, including approximately 199 males and 188 females, with a sex ratio of 944 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 33 children aged 0–6 years in Dandapur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• The literacy rate of Dandapur village is about 73.39%, with male literacy at 84.42% and female literacy at 61.70%.
  • There are around 79 households in Dandapur village.

Connectivity of Dandap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dandapur. As per the 2011 stats, Dandap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
